| Full Name |
Claudette Colbert |
| Date of Birth |
13 September 1903 |
| Place of Birth |
Saint-Mandé, Seine, France |
| Date of Death |
30 July 1996 |
| Place of Death |
Speightstown, Saint Peter, Barbados |
| Citizenship / Country of Residence |
American; Resided in Barbados |
| Education |
Art Students League of New York |
| Profession |
Actress |
| Years of Activity |
1923-1987 |
| Brief Information |
Claudette Colbert was an American actress who began her career in Broadway productions in the 1920s before transitioning to film. She became one of the highest-paid stars in Hollywood during the 1930s and 1940s, known for her roles in screwball comedies and dramas. Colbert won an Academy Award for Best Actress for her performance in "It Happened One Night" (1934). |
